Actor Hugh Jackman is reportedly trying to make peace with ex-wife Deborra-Lee Furness by accepting blame for the breakdown of their marriage. His effort comes ahead of his daughter Ava’s 21st birthday, as the actor hopes the family can celebrate the occasion together.

wolverine Star Hugh Jackman is desperate to end his ongoing war with ex-wife Deborra-Lee Furness, and intends to do so by finally admitting to bestial behavior during their relationship.

RadarOnline reports that Jackman is ready to accept responsibility for the divorce and has stated that he did not mean to hurt Furness. According to the outlet, a source said, “He is willing to take full responsibility for his part in the breakdown of their marriage. Hugh never intended to hurt Deb.”

While the former couple may have celebrated 30 years of marriage on April 11, it’s their daughter Ava Jackman’s 21st birthday that the actor is desperate to reconcile. Both of them also have a 25-year-old son, Oscar.

The report quoted a source as saying, “Ava will turn 21 in July and Hugh wants them all to celebrate this moment together. That’s why he’s really pushing to work things out with Deb.”

The report states, “He wants to be heard, and his hope is that she’ll be able to take her part in things, too. But if Deb still isn’t there, Hugh says he doesn’t mind continuing to bear the brunt of the blame if it means they can get some peace.”

Rumors have swirled that the pair’s decades-long relationship broke down in 2023 after he became inappropriately close to young Broadway costar Sutton Foster.

Furness, 70, confirmed the scandalous affair when she filed for divorce in May 2025 — four months after the Missing Links actor, 57, and the Bunheads star, 51, went public with their forbidden offstage romance.

Furness said in a scathing statement, “My heart and compassion go out to all who have endured the painful journey of betrayal. This is a tragedy that wounds deeply.”

Despite their divorce being finalized in June 2025, the ill will remains.
